Golden Sun: Dark Dawn is a role-playing game developed by Camelot Software Planning, released in 2010 for the Nintendo DS. The third entry in the Golden Sun series, it follows the descendants of the protagonists from the earlier games, establishing a new generation of characters within the established setting. The game incorporates the DS's touch-screen capabilities as a core part of its control scheme, integrating them into navigation and the series' signature Psynergy-based puzzle and combat mechanics. Visually, the title represents a significant upgrade over its Game Boy Advance predecessors, taking advantage of the DS hardware to deliver more detailed environments and character presentation. The roughly six-year gap between Dark Dawn and the previous installment, Golden Sun: The Lost Age, marked a notable return for the long-dormant franchise.
